To quit smoking not only has the desire or intention are the most important is the action / attempt to stop and it must be consistent in running. Let's discuss what steps that must be done before & after quitting smoking.
First you must have a desire to stop smoking. This way by realizing that smoking not only damage your health but people around you, including people who you love. Become aware of how selfish you are when smoking.
Second, try to browse the smoking habits of you who has been done so far as:
- When do you often smoke,
- What do you desire to smoke,
- Where are you smoking.
Third, make the list of reason why should you stop smoking, as:
- Avoidance of cancer, heart failure, indigestion,
- Adding a severe disease that you suffer now,
- Protect your family from diseases caused by smoking,
- Provide an example to your children not to smoke,
- Conserve the expenditure for cigarettes.
Fourth, determine the day, date, hour & seconds when you will stop smoking. Do it immediately and inform the people around you if you've quit smoking, ask for their help to support you. Discard all cigarette & your smoking equipment, do not be stored.
Fifth, the most difficult stage is you must be consistent in your mission to quit smoking, that is:
- Avoid places where non-smoking, like bars, smoking areas,
- Always say I've quit smoking if you are offered cigarettes by your friend,
- Say to yourself, I should quit smoking, if the desire to smoke comes,
- Make exercise a routine,
- Do a routine exercise.
Sixth, in an attempt to stop smoking, eat the low-calorie foods and drinking water as much as possible.
